micrometer-core的原理是基于度量器(Meter)和度量注册表(MeterRegistry)。度量器是用于度量应用程序某个特定指标的对象,比如计数器用来度量某个事件发生的次数,计时器用来度量某个操作的耗时。度量注册表是用来管理度量器的容器,它可以用来注册、注销度量器,并且可以将度量数据发送到监控系统中。 在micrometer-core中,度...
Micrometer的核心原理是使用Metrics API来收集应用程序的度量数据,并将其导出到不同的度量系统和监控工具中。 Micrometer的设计目标是提供一个简单、统一的API,用于收集和导出应用程序的度量数据。它提供了一组核心的度量类型,如计数器(Counter)、计时器(Timer)、直方图(Histogram)和分布式摘要(Summary),用于描述应用...
public void bindTo(MeterRegistry registry) { // 请求相关度量注册MeterRegistry[先注册micrometer,PrometheusMeterRegistry,后注册prometheus的CollectorRegistry] registerGlobalRequestMetrics(registry); registerServletMetrics(registry); registerCacheMetrics(registry); registerThreadPoolMetrics(registry); registerSessionMetr...
遇到“io.micrometer.core.instrument.Tags.zip([Ljava/lang/String;)Lio/micrometer/core/instrument/...
An application observability facade for the most popular observability tools. Think SLF4J, but for observability. - micrometer/micrometer-core/src/test/java/io/micrometer/core/aop/TimedAspectTest.java at main · micrometer-metrics/micrometer
第一步:什么是Micrometer? Micrometer是一个度量工具库,用于收集和聚合分布式系统中的度量数据。它可以帮助开发人员监控应用程序的性能和健康状况,并提供有关系统指标的实时和历史数据。Micrometer通过一组API提供了一种简单且统一的方式来管理度量数据。 第二步:什么是数据收集器? Micrometer提供了一组数据收集器,用于...
本文将介绍Micrometer的core包中的counter方法,包括其使用方法和常见用法。 一、counter方法概述 counter方法是Micrometer中用于创建计数器的核心方法之一。计数器是一种度量指标,用于记录某个事件发生的次数。通过使用counter方法,可以方便地创建计数器对象,并使用它来记录事件的发生次数。 二、counter方法的用法 在Micro...
io.micrometer.core.instrument.util.NamedThreadFactory 是Micrometer 框架中的一个工具类,用于创建具有自定义名称的线程。以下是对 NamedThreadFactory 的详细解答: 1. NamedThreadFactory 的用途 NamedThreadFactory 的主要用途是为线程池中的线程提供一个有意义的名称,这有助于在调试和监控过程中更容易地识别和跟踪线程...
使用micrometer将spring boot actuator的数据上报到滴滴夜莺(nightingale)中 版本更新 1.6.5更新说明 新增了自动注册节点功能,依赖同步为micrometer-core 1.6.5版本 1.6.4更新说明 新增自动获取endpoint功能,新增指标屏蔽功能 1.6.3更新说明 初始版本,实现数据上报到n9e中 ...
Bumpsio.micrometer:micrometer-corefrom 1.13.7 to 1.14.0. Release notes io.micrometer:micrometer-core's releases 1.14.0 Micrometer 1.14.0 is the GA version of a new feature release. See oursupport policyfor support timelines. Below are the combined release notes of all the pre-release mile...